We hope to answer some of your questions about wellness IV drips.

Wellness IV drips are intravenous infusions of vitamins, minerals, and other nutrients delivered directly into the bloodstream. This allows for faster and more efficient absorption, providing your body with a quick boost of hydration, energy, and vital nutrients.

Wellness IV drips can help boost energy, improve immune function, enhance recovery from workouts or illness, alleviate symptoms of fatigue, migraines, and even support weight loss. They can also help improve hydration and nutrient absorption.

Yes, IV therapy is generally safe when administered by trained healthcare professionals. At Meeting Point Health, our IV drips are administered by experienced practitioners who monitor your treatment to ensure safety and efficacy.

Most wellness IV drip sessions take about 30 to 60 minutes, depending on the type of drip and your body’s absorption rate.

The frequency of IV therapy depends on your individual health needs and goals. Some people benefit from weekly or bi-weekly treatments, while others may only need occasional boosts, such as after a workout, illness, or travel.

IV therapy can benefit a wide range of people, from athletes looking to boost recovery to individuals experiencing fatigue, dehydration, or nutrient deficiencies. It can also support people with busy, stressful lifestyles or those recovering from illness.
